This consultancy is an opportunity to support UNICEF’s leadership of the Regional Working Group (RWG) Secretariat for Immunization in West and Central Africa during its chairing period. The consultant will ensure the effective coordination, monitoring and continuity of RWG governance across 24 countries, supporting implementation of Gavi 6.0 processes, the VPOP framework and National Immunization Strategy development. As a core member of the RWG Secretariat and Monitoring and Evaluation Technical Working Group, the consultant will coordinate partner engagement, strengthen technical working groups, manage monitoring dashboards and reporting, and ensure timely follow‑up of RWG recommendations to advance IA2030 immunization goals across the region.

If you are a committed and analytical public health professional with experience in child health and health systems, UNICEF Philippines invites you to apply as Consultant for Integrated Management of Newborn and Childhood Illnesses (IMNCI) Manual Updating and Capacity Building) under the Health Section.
The consultant will support the Department of Health (DOH) in updating the IMNCI Manual and strengthening training protocols in line with national guidelines and evolving health needs. The role includes conducting stakeholder consultations and a landscape analysis to identify opportunities for integrating community-based IMNCI through Barangay Health Workers (BHWs) and Barangay Nutrition Scholars (BNSs). Working closely with DOH and partners, the consultant will help enhance service delivery and capacity of health workers at the primary health care level. This assignment contributes to improving quality, equitable health services and reducing childhood morbidity and mortality in line with national priorities.
If you are a dedicated and analytical public health professional with experience in maternal and early childhood nutrition, UNICEF Philippines invites you to apply as Consultant for Nutrition under the Health Section. The consultant will provide technical and operational support in advancing nutrition initiatives through advocacy, policy development, and systems strengthening in close collaboration with the Department of Health. The role will focus on supporting the development and finalization of key policies, including the Administrative Order on the Establishment of Nutrition Support Groups, as well as strengthening maternal nutrition interventions such as the transition to Multiple Micronutrient Supplementation. Working under the supervision of the Nutrition Specialist, the consultant will coordinate with national and subnational stakeholders to ensure effective planning, implementation, and monitoring of nutrition programs. The assignment will contribute to improving maternal and child nutrition outcomes and ensuring alignment with national priorities and global standards.
